Here's a breakdown of the winter break duration and dates for different states and Union Territories. Jammu and Kashmir faces prolonged winter holidays due to extreme weather conditions. Schools in the region closed on December 1 for classes 1-8 and on December 11 for higher standards, with no expected reopening date until late February. In Haryana, students can look forward to a 15-day winter break from January 1 to January 15. Meanwhile, Punjab, Uttarakhand, and Chandigarh have yet to finalize their dates but are expected to follow a similar pattern in the first half of January. Uttar Pradesh has announced a 12-day winter break from December 20 to December 31, providing students with a brief respite before the new year begins. Madhya Pradesh's winter break is scheduled to start on December 23 and is likely to last until the beginning of January. PM Shri Schools have declared a 10-day winter break from December 23 to January 1, giving students a relatively shorter holiday period compared to other states.
